Jun 06 2006 - Episode One Available Now - Updates Released By Scarchelli  
Valve Launches First of an Episodic Trilogy

Bellevue, WA, June 1, 2006 - Valve®, developer of the blockbuster series Half-Life® and Counter-StrikeTM, announced Half-Life® 2: Episode One is now available via Steamgames.com for just $19.95 and at retail outlets around the world.

The first in a trilogy of episodic games, Episode One reveals the aftermath of Half-Life 2 and launches a journey beyond City 17. Episode One does not require Half-Life 2 to play and also includes a first look at Episode Two, which will ship by year's end.

In addition to the new single player experience, two multiplayer games are included. And those who purchase Episode One will have free access via Steam (www.steamgames.com) to Half-Life 2: Lost Coast, the interactive technology demo that introduces High Dynamic Range lighting to the SourceTM Engine, Valve's award-winning game technology.

As Episode One is now available, there are updates being released already. The updates will be applied automatically when your Steam client is restarted. The specific changes include: Fixed the game's difficulty defaulting to "Easy" instead of "Normal" when starting a new game. (If you've already played Episode One, you can change the setting manually by selecting "Options" from the game's main menu.)

Sep 28 2005 - Counter-Strike: Source and Half-Life 1: Anthology hit Retail By VeGiTAX2  
Straight from Valve we have the latest on new retail releases.

"In addition to the latest version of the world's number 1 online action game, Counter-Strike: Source also includes Half-Life 2: Deathmatch and Day of Defeat®: Source, the latest version of the popular WWII online action game from Valve. Meanwhile, the Half-Life 1: Anthology includes the original game, which earned over 50 game of the year awards and launched a franchise with over 15 million retail units sold, plus Half-Life: Opposing Force®, Half-Life: Blueshift®, and Team Fortress® Classic. Both products will ship to territories worldwide in the coming weeks."

For multiplayer fans this breaks them free from having to purchase HL2 to get one or both titles especially since DoD: Source wasn't available to all buyers.

    Jul 02 2005 - The Valve Developer Community By 0Zero0  
    Valve has recently opened a website called The Valve Developer Community, which allows all modders, modelers, mappers, and anyone else with an interest in playing with the Source code to come together as a community and gather information from each other. This allows and encourages everyone to share any tips they may have with fellow modders, as well as help those interested in learning about the art.

    The website uses a wiki, which is an application that allows all users to add and make changes to each other's content.

    Apr 18 2005 - Firearms Release Schedule By xpronic  
    Firearms 3.0 has been finished, and is now on the way to mirrors and hosts. The Linux build will be released Monday evening EST (18/04/05), and the Windows build will come out the following Tuesday morning EST (19/04/05).

      Changes/Additions:
      * Fixed treating concussion crash
      * Fixed healing ammobox crash
      * Fixed 'ghosting' spectator bug
      * Moved scoreboard to last on the VGUI stack (means its always on top of everything else)
      * Installed Global FA ban for caught cheaters
      * Lowered penetration distances on all rifles
      * Turned on FA Hard Code ban list and added all FAL ban ID's and Verified Jolt ban ID's
      * Reduced Sniper Rifles ability to shoot while unscoped (cannot effectively shotgun snipe anymore)
      * Increased accuracy of all weapons roughly by 25%
      * Changed Armor back to original 2.9 values: (Absorbtion Amount-- 80% Heavy, 70% Medium, 60% Light)
      * Added AK74 nomenclature reload/animations
      * Added MP5a5 nomenclature reload/animations
      * Added Anaconda nomenclature reload/animations
      * fixed treat reload bandage exploit

      MAPS:
      * Added new Texture Details for maps: OBJ_Vengeance, PS_Upham, SD_Durandal, SDTC_Balcome, TC_Basrah, TC_caen, TC_Iwojima.
      * Added new map OBJ_Vengeance
      * Added new version of TC_Caen

    Dec 23 2004 - Valve Bans Additional 30,000 Steam Accounts By Ace  
    Saw over at ShackNews that Valve has banned another 30,000 STEAM accounts because of fraud.


    Today Valve disabled more than 30,000 Steam accounts which had been used to try to illegally gain access to Valve games without a valid purchase.


    Valve takes such activities seriously and reserves the right to disable Steam accounts engaging in piracy, cheating, illegal activities, or any other activity in violation of the Steam Subscriber Agreement.



    Sometimes I wonder about people. Trying to defraud a service like Steam is like trying to commit credit card fraud using your real name and address - it is not going to fly because they have information on YOU specifically, in this case, the Steam account information.
